ABSTRACT:
A method of and a device for accurately positioning a measuring means such as a measurement probe relative to that target area of a living body which has a unique marking peculiar to the living body. A transparent sheet member is first applied to the target part, and an image of the unique marking is then transferred onto the transparent sheet member. The transparent sheet member bearing the image of the unique marking is associated with the measuring device so that a subsequent measurement can be performed by the measuring device after the image transferred onto the transparent sheet member has been aligned with the unique marking in the target area.
